Overview

Interactive Investor was founded in 1995 and is headquartered in UK, while Virtual Brokers was established in 2008 and is based in Canada. Interactive Investor holds licences including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), while Virtual Brokers is regulated by The Investment Industry Regulatory Organization of Canada (IIROC) among others. Interactive Investor serves 10,000+ clients worldwide; Virtual Brokers has 10,000+. The minimum deposit is $1 at Interactive Investor and $1000 at Virtual Brokers.

Fees

Fees are a critical factor when choosing between Interactive Investor and Virtual Brokers, directly affecting your bottom line as a trader. Interactive Investor has a lower barrier to entry with a minimum deposit of $1 (vs $1000 at Virtual Brokers). Virtual Brokers charges withdrawal fees while Interactive Investor does not, giving Interactive Investor an edge for frequent withdrawers. Interactive Investor applies inactivity fees on dormant accounts; Virtual Brokers does not. Virtual Brokers charges deposit fees; Interactive Investor does not. Overall, Interactive Investor scores higher on fees in our assessment.

Education & Research

Education and research tools help traders at every level make more informed decisions, and here's how Interactive Investor and Virtual Brokers compare. Virtual Brokers runs regular live webinars; Interactive Investor does not. Both provide video tutorials. Virtual Brokers publishes daily market commentary; Interactive Investor does not. Both integrate third-party research tools. Virtual Brokers maintains an archive of past webinars for on-demand viewing. Virtual Brokers scores higher overall in education and research.
